Widener Changes Rule

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Periodicals, which hitherto have circulated for a week, may not leave Widener again after April 3, Keyes D. Metcalf, director of the University Libraries, announced yesterday.

The Faculty Library Committee ruling comes as a result of a great many complaints by professors in the past year. The regulation is intended to prevent the loss of irreplaceable periodicals.
